P4Green : Une nouvelle stratégie pour l'efficacité énergétique dans les centres de données
P4Green vise à réduire la consommation d'énergie dans les centres de données avec une technologie programmable.
― 7 min lire
Table des matières
Les centres de données consomment beaucoup d'énergie, et cette demande augmente rapidement. Avec cette hausse, c'est super important de trouver des moyens de réduire la consommation d'énergie. Réduire l'utilisation d'énergie aide non seulement à économiser de l'argent, mais aussi à diminuer l'impact environnemental.
Un moyen que les chercheurs utilisent pour résoudre ce problème, c'est une nouvelle technologie appelée Réseautage défini par logiciel (SDN) et des plans de données programmables. Ces technologies aident à gérer la manière dont les données circulent dans un réseau de manière plus efficace. Un système en test, appelé P4Green, vise à économiser de l'énergie dans les centres de données en utilisant moins de commutateurs réseau et en dirigeant les tâches vers des serveurs qui peuvent utiliser des énergies renouvelables.
Consommation d'énergie dans les centres de données
Les centres de données sont essentiels pour les services cloud et le traitement de grandes quantités de données. Ils consomment une part importante de l'énergie mondiale. Environ 40-50% de l'énergie totale dans un centre de données est utilisée par l'infrastructure réseau, et ce pourcentage devrait augmenter dans un avenir proche. À mesure que la technologie progresse, les composants des centres de données non liés à l'informatique utiliseront moins d'énergie. Donc, trouver des moyens de rendre l'informatique et le réseau plus efficaces est essentiel.
D'ici 2030, la consommation d'énergie devrait augmenter de 20% à moins que des changements importants ne soient faits. La fin des améliorations technologiques traditionnelles pourrait même entraîner une augmentation de la consommation d'énergie allant jusqu'à 134%. Même les commutateurs dans le réseau qui envoient peu de données peuvent encore consommer beaucoup d'énergie. Les meilleures méthodes actuelles suggèrent qu'une planification soigneuse de la structure du centre de données peut aider à utiliser les ressources disponibles judicieusement.
De plus, pour les serveurs, diverses techniques, comme la planification de charge de travail et la virtualisation, ont été suggérées pour réduire la demande énergétique. Utiliser de l'Énergie renouvelable peut aider à diminuer l'empreinte carbone des serveurs, mais l'inconstance de l'approvisionnement en énergie renouvelable et les coûts de stockage sont des obstacles significatifs.
Présentation de P4Green
P4Green est une nouvelle approche conçue pour réduire la consommation d'énergie dans les centres de données. Contrairement à d'autres systèmes, P4Green ne nécessite pas de matériel spécial et repose sur des commutateurs programmables à la place. Cela signifie que les commutateurs peuvent être configurés de plusieurs manières pour améliorer les performances en fonction des conditions de trafic actuelles et de la disponibilité de l'énergie.
Le système utilise un langage de programmation appelé P4 pour gérer le plan de données (la partie qui gère le flux de données réel) et l'API P4Runtime pour gérer les opérations. P4Green se concentre sur deux tâches principales : optimiser la manière dont les données circulent à travers les commutateurs et choisir quels serveurs gèrent les charges de travail en fonction de leur disponibilité en énergie renouvelable.
Comment P4Green fonctionne
Consolidation du trafic
La consolidation du trafic fait référence à la capacité de réduire le nombre de commutateurs réseau actifs nécessaires en fonction de la quantité de trafic actuel. P4Green ajuste le nombre de commutateurs utilisés en fonction de la quantité de données entrantes. Quand le trafic est faible, moins de commutateurs sont actifs, ce qui entraîne des économies d'énergie significatives. Par exemple, si le trafic n'a besoin que d'un commutateur, en utiliser plus serait une perte d'énergie.
Le système mesure le trafic à intervalles réguliers et décide d'activer ou de désactiver les commutateurs en fonction du volume. Cette flexibilité permet à P4Green de maintenir des performances sans surcharger un commutateur en particulier.
Contrôle de charge de travail
Une autre fonctionnalité importante de P4Green est le contrôle de charge de travail, qui permet au système de diriger les tâches vers les serveurs qui ont le plus d'énergie renouvelable disponible. Différents serveurs peuvent avoir accès à différents niveaux d'énergie renouvelable, et P4Green aide à équilibrer efficacement les charges de travail.
Quand un serveur a beaucoup d'énergie renouvelable, il peut gérer plus de tâches. Le système surveille ces informations et prend des décisions sur l'endroit où envoyer les demandes entrantes. Si un serveur commence à manquer d'énergie renouvelable, le système peut rapidement rediriger les tâches vers un autre serveur qui a plus d'énergie disponible.
Tester P4Green
Pour tester l'efficacité de P4Green, une simulation a été créée avec une configuration réseau comprenant plusieurs serveurs et commutateurs. Des schémas de trafic ont été simulés pour imiter ce qui se passe dans un centre de données typique. Pendant les tests, on a observé comment P4Green gérait la charge de travail et le fonctionnement des commutateurs pendant des conditions de trafic changeantes.
Les résultats ont montré que P4Green pouvait réduire significativement le nombre de commutateurs actifs tout en répartissant efficacement les charges de travail en fonction de la disponibilité de l'énergie renouvelable. En utilisant cette méthode, la consommation d'énergie dans le réseau était nettement plus basse.
Avantages de P4Green
P4Green offre plusieurs avantages par rapport aux systèmes traditionnels. Ces avantages incluent :
Réduction de la consommation d'énergie : En utilisant moins de commutateurs et en dirigeant les charges de travail plus efficacement, P4Green minimise l'énergie nécessaire pour les opérations.
Flexibilité : La nature programmable de P4Green permet des ajustements rapides en réponse aux conditions de trafic changeantes et à la disponibilité de l'énergie.
Économies de coûts : Moins d'utilisation d'énergie se traduit par des coûts opérationnels plus bas pour les centres de données.
Impact environnemental : Utiliser plus d'énergie renouvelable aide à réduire l'empreinte carbone des centres de données, ce qui est bénéfique pour l'environnement.
Défis
Bien que P4Green présente une solution prometteuse, il y a des défis à prendre en compte. Par exemple, les commutateurs programmables doivent avoir la bonne technologie pour gérer efficacement les charges de travail dynamiques. De plus, la gestion des ressources d'énergie renouvelable peut être complexe en raison de leur nature imprévisible.
En outre, la transition des systèmes traditionnels vers de nouvelles approches comme P4Green peut nécessiter des ajustements significatifs dans l'infrastructure et les processus. Les opérateurs de centres de données doivent être prêts à investir du temps et des ressources pour s'adapter à ces changements.
Conclusion
Les demandes énergétiques des centres de données sont appelées à croître, ce qui rend crucial de trouver des moyens efficaces de réduire la consommation d'énergie. P4Green représente une approche innovante en tirant parti des technologies de réseau programmables pour optimiser l'utilisation de l'énergie et améliorer l'efficacité.
Alors que les centres de données deviennent plus dépendants de l'énergie renouvelable, des systèmes comme P4Green peuvent aider à gérer ces ressources pour garantir que les opérations soient à la fois rentables et respectueuses de l'environnement. Bien que des défis demeurent, la recherche et le développement continus mèneront à de meilleures solutions pour gérer la consommation d'énergie dans les centres de données.
Ce système montre qu'avec la bonne technologie, il est possible d'équilibrer les besoins opérationnels et les objectifs de durabilité.
Titre: Towards Greener Data Centers via Programmable Data Plane
Résumé: The energy demands of data centers are increasing and are expected to grow exponentially. Reducing the energy consumption of data centers decreases operational expenses, as well as their carbon footprint. We design techniques to reduce data center power consumption by leveraging Software-Defined Networking (SDN) and programmable data plane concepts. Relying solely on in-data plane registers, our proposed system P4Green consolidates traffic in the least number of network switches and shifts workloads to the servers with the available renewable energy. Unlike existing SDN-based solutions, P4Green's operation does not depend on a centralized controller, making the system scalable and failure-resistant. Our proof-of-concept simulations show that traffic consolidation can reduce data centers' aggregation switch usage by 36% compared to standard data center load balancing techniques, while workload control can boost renewable energy consumption for 46% of the daily traffic.
Auteurs: Garegin Grigoryan, Minseok Kwon
Dernière mise à jour: 2023-06-24 00:00:00
Langue: English
Source URL: https://arxiv.org/abs/2306.13983
Source PDF: https://arxiv.org/pdf/2306.13983
Licence: https://creativecommons.org/licenses/by/4.0/
Changements: Ce résumé a été créé avec l'aide de l'IA et peut contenir des inexactitudes. Pour obtenir des informations précises, veuillez vous référer aux documents sources originaux dont les liens figurent ici.
Merci à arxiv pour l'utilisation de son interopérabilité en libre accès.